In the world of heating, ventilation, and air conditioning (HVAC), precision and safety are paramount. At the heart of many modern furnace and heating system safety circuits lies a critical, yet often overlooked component: the fan and limit control switch. This device is the unsung hero that ensures your heating system operates not only efficiently but also safely, protecting both the equipment and your home.

A fan and limit control switch is a multi-functional device typically installed on the furnace plenum or heat exchanger. Its primary roles are threefold: to activate the system's blower fan, to monitor the plenum temperature, and to shut down the burner if unsafe temperatures are detected. It acts as the system's brain for thermal management. The "fan" control portion turns the blower motor on once the heat exchanger warms up to a set temperature, usually around 130°F to 140°F, ensuring that warm air is circulated throughout your ductwork. Conversely, it turns the blower off shortly after the burner cycles off, allowing the residual heat to be used and preventing cold air from being blown into your living spaces.

The "limit" function is the critical safety guard. It continuously monitors the plenum temperature. If the temperature rises to an abnormally high level—often due to restricted airflow from a dirty filter, blocked vents, or a failing blower motor—the limit switch will interrupt the electrical circuit to the burner, shutting off the heat source to prevent overheating. This prevents potential damage to the heat exchanger, which can be costly to repair, and mitigates serious fire hazards. Once the plenum cools to a safe reset temperature, the switch will automatically allow the burner to reignite, restoring operation.

Understanding the signs of a malfunctioning fan and limit control switch is crucial for proactive maintenance. Common symptoms include the blower fan not turning on at all, resulting in inadequate heat distribution and potential overheating shutdowns. Alternatively, the fan may run continuously, even when the burner is off, leading to cold drafts and higher energy bills. Frequent, short cycling of the furnace, where it turns on and off rapidly, can also point to a limit switch that is tripping prematurely due to calibration drift or sensing errors. Ignoring these signs can lead to reduced system efficiency, uncomfortable temperature swings, and increased wear on major components.

For optimal performance, regular HVAC maintenance is non-negotiable. This includes changing air filters every one to three months to ensure proper airflow, which is the most common cause of limit switch trips. Keeping vents and registers unobstructed allows the system to breathe easily. While some basic visual inspections for obvious damage or corrosion can be done by a homeowner, testing the switch's calibration and operation requires a multimeter and technical knowledge. Therefore, having a certified HVAC technician inspect and test the fan and limit control switch during an annual tune-up is a wise investment. They can verify the activation temperatures are within the manufacturer's specifications and ensure the safety circuit is functioning correctly.

Modern advancements have led to more sophisticated electronic versions of these controls, offering greater accuracy and diagnostic capabilities. However, the fundamental principle remains unchanged: to orchestrate the safe and efficient delivery of heat. When selecting a replacement, it is vital to choose a switch with the correct temperature ratings and electrical specifications for your specific furnace model. Using an incompatible switch can compromise both safety and efficiency.
